2017 AUD to SGD Performance & Market Timing Review

Analysis of key historical highlights and timing insights for 2017

During 2017, the AUD to SGD exchange rate experienced significant fluctuation. The market reached its absolute peak on February 15, valuing the pair at 1.0951. Conversely, the yearly low was recorded on December 8, dropping to 1.0151.

This high-to-low spread represents a total annual volatility of 0.0800 SGD. From a start-to-finish perspective, comparing the January average rate of 1.0659 to the December average rate of 1.0301, the exchange rate registered a net change of -3.36% (reflecting a weakening trend).

Looking at year-over-year peak valuations, the 2017 high of 1.0951 was up 1.84% compared to the 2016 peak of 1.0753, indicating shifts in long-term support levels.

Monthly Breakdown

Statistical summary for each calendar month.

Month High Low Average
January 1.0811 1.0437 1.0659
February 1.0951 1.0716 1.0845
March 1.0816 1.0635 1.0711
April 1.0661 1.0435 1.0543
May 1.0516 1.0276 1.0366
June 1.0597 1.0233 1.0453
July 1.0894 1.0479 1.0694
August 1.0825 1.0697 1.0771
September 1.0834 1.0634 1.0760
October 1.0706 1.0435 1.0592
November 1.0482 1.0194 1.0336
December 1.0444 1.0151 1.0301
